Not sure about that one.
Three issues:
1. Automatic. Then again I guess that's true of most of it's competition.
2. The power bulge hood looks awkward from the side. It reminds me of the Mustang Cobra hoods (didn't like them either).
3. That body work is really poor. The fit and finish is fine but it looks very fast and furious. Who is this car actually marketed at? Execs who might otherwise go to AMG or boi racers who have money?

On point 2: Definitely agree here. It looks strange, and the rake up to the bulge part is weird.
On point 3: I would say that the new face is the worst part. The sides and rear (if we can see it) are generally fine, although in the 3-quarter view the body around the rear well does look like it's hanging wrong, or like the wheel is pushed in. But the center of the front fascia is ripped off of the now-deceased 2002-2003 Sentra SE-R with the caved-in center and squared-off intake. Also, the high corners behind each fog light are unusually sharply cut for a factory-styled product. The whee;s are hot though, but seem Infiniti inspired.
The interior of course is fine. No big canges there save the wheel and F badges. If this blue is the signature color of the car, it's pretty. It's not terribly original, but it's pretty.
